访问Google云存储桶中的私有文件需要进行身份验证和授权。以下是一个完善且全面的答案:
Google云存储桶是Google Cloud Platform(GCP)提供的一种对象存储服务,用于存储和管理各种类型的文件。私有文件是指只有经过授权的用户才能访问的文件。
要访问Google云存储桶中的私有文件,可以通过以下步骤进行:
- 身份验证:首先,用户需要进行身份验证,以证明自己有权访问私有文件。Google Cloud Platform提供了多种身份验证方式,包括使用Google账号、服务账号、OAuth 2.0等。用户可以根据自己的需求选择适合的身份验证方式。
- 授权访问:一旦身份验证成功,用户需要获得访问私有文件的授权。在Google云存储中,可以使用访问控制列表(ACL)或者使用预定义的角色和权限(IAM)来授权访问。ACL允许用户直接授予特定用户或用户组访问权限,而IAM提供了更细粒度的访问控制,可以基于角色和权限来管理访问。
- 访问私有文件:一旦完成身份验证和授权,用户可以使用各种方法来访问私有文件。例如,可以使用Google Cloud Storage API进行编程访问,也可以使用Google Cloud Console进行可视化操作。此外,还可以使用各种开发工具和SDK来访问私有文件。
Google Cloud Platform提供了一系列与云存储桶相关的产品和服务,可以帮助用户更好地管理和使用私有文件。以下是一些相关产品和服务的介绍:
- Google Cloud Storage:Google Cloud Storage是Google提供的可扩展的对象存储服务,用于存储和检索各种类型的数据。它提供了高可靠性、高可用性和高性能,并具有强大的安全性和访问控制功能。
- Google Cloud IAM:Google Cloud IAM(Identity and Access Management)是Google Cloud Platform的访问控制服务,用于管理用户、角色和权限。通过IAM,用户可以对私有文件进行细粒度的访问控制和授权管理。
- Google Cloud Storage API:Google Cloud Storage API是一组RESTful API,用于与Google云存储桶进行交互。用户可以使用API进行文件的上传、下载、复制、删除等操作,以及管理访问权限和存储桶的其他属性。
- Google Cloud SDK:Google Cloud SDK是一组命令行工具和库,用于与Google Cloud Platform进行交互和管理。用户可以使用SDK来访问私有文件,执行各种操作,并进行开发和调试。
总结起来,访问Google云存储桶中的私有文件需要进行身份验证和授权。Google Cloud Platform提供了多种身份验证方式和访问控制机制,用户可以根据自己的需求选择适合的方式。同时,Google Cloud Platform还提供了一系列与云存储桶相关的产品和服务,帮助用户更好地管理和使用私有文件。